Output af11843709e5a09a830aacc5a502ee6914bdba12191106e11625ab9677d7b368:0

value
5706000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2701e838efc706a1b4b71e8cb9b957a3cc0ba94b OP_EQUAL
address
35FGZXvtMikt82k4FiwiRMA8mQDyRfH3Yu
transaction
af11843709e5a09a830aacc5a502ee6914bdba12191106e11625ab9677d7b368
confirmations
145463
spent
true